Bill Summary
Relative to out of state operator motor vehicle license applications. Transportation.
AI Summary
This bill amends the first paragraph of Section 8 of Chapter 90 of the Massachusetts General Laws, which relates to motor vehicle license applications. The key provision is that the Registrar of Motor Vehicles must require an applicant surrendering an out-of-state or U.S. territory driver's license to successfully complete the examination and driving test for a junior operator's license, which includes a behind-the-wheel driving test. This change is intended to ensure that all drivers operating in Massachusetts demonstrate the necessary skills and knowledge, regardless of their previous licensing jurisdiction.
